Silicon carbide crude is produced by mixing silica (SiO2) with carbon (C) in an electric resistance furnace at temperatures around 2,500 C. The chemical reaction in the SiC process may be represented by the formula: SiO2 + 3C SiC + 2CO. Sic usually appears in parentheses or brackets, sometimes with the letters in italics. In this context it means “intentionally so written.” On its own, sic means “so” or “thus” and can be found in phrases such as sic transit gloria mundi ("so passes away the glory of the world") and sic semper tyrannis ("thus ever to tyrants," the motto of the state of ia).

Due to this limitation, today''s SiC substrates are manufactured with a gas phase method that can produce 4H-SiC bulk single crystals. Sublimation takes place at temperatures of at least 2,300 °C. Stresses associated with the high temperatures, and cooling down from them, give rise to thermal stress.

SIC-20 confirms that in applying the equity method of accounting, the investor normally stops recording its share of the continuing losses of an associate once the carrying amounts of financial interests which are accounted for under the equity method are reduced to nil.
